Transaction f23fb13bf9fe23be2719bdba9504193022c43a096fb6cfe225ba18440a9bbb9c

1 Input
2 Outputs
  • f23fb13bf9fe23be2719bdba9504193022c43a096fb6cfe225ba18440a9bbb9c:0
  • value  27377233
    address  3CvY19uLBcp75HH4mFTxciUKRjCVx2moXE
  • f23fb13bf9fe23be2719bdba9504193022c43a096fb6cfe225ba18440a9bbb9c:1
  • value  1890100
    address  17d8saN3a3f5BGHiezTgQTL3kTui7MD4Zs